Abstract

Official abstract text for this publication.

The present invention relates to aryl sulphide and aryl sulphoxide derivatives, to their use as acaricides and insecticides for controlling animal pests and to processes and intermediates for their preparation. The aryl sulphide and aryl sulphoxide derivatives have the general structure (I) in which the respective radicals have the meanings given in the description.

First claim

Opening claim text (preview).

The invention claimed is: 1. A compound of formula (I) wherein A and B together with the carbon atoms to which they are attached represent a substructure selected from the group consisting of in which the labels (A) and (B) define the respective points of attachment of the radicals A and B of the general formula (I) and R 1 , R 2 and R 3 have the following meanings:  R 1 represents hydrogen, methyl, ethyl, propyl, isobutyl, butyl, sec-butyl, isopropyl, tert-butyl, trifluoromethyl, (2,2,2)-trifluoroethyl, difluoromethyl, (2,2)-difluoroethyl, trichloromethyl, (2,2,2)-trichloroethyl, vinyl, ethynyl, allyl, butenyl, propynyl, methoxycarbonyl, ethylcarbonyl, propylcarbonyl, methoxycarbonyl, ethoxycarbonyl, methylsulphonylamino, ethylsulphonylamino, propylsulphonylamino, aminosulphonyl, methylaminosulphonyl, ethylaminosulphonyl, propylaminosulphonyl, dimethylaminosulphonyl, diethylaminosulphonyl, aminothiocarbonyl, methylaminothiocarbonyl, ethylaminothiocarbonyl, dimethylaminothiocarbonyl or diethylaminothiocarbonyl;  or represent cyclopropyl, cyclobutyl, cyclopentyl or cyclohexyl which are mono- or polysubstituted by identical or different substituents from the group consisting of fluorine, chlorine, bromine, cyano, nitro, methyl, ethyl, methoxy, ethoxy, trifluoromethyl and cyclopropyl;  or represents cyclopropylmethyl or cyclobutylmethyl which are mono- or polysubstituted by identical or different substituents from the group consisting of fluorine, chlorine, bromine, cyano, nitro, methyl, ethyl, trifluoromethyl and cyclopropyl;  R 2 and R 3 independently of one another represent hydrogen, fluorine, chlorine, bromine, iodine, hydroxy, amino, cyano, nitro, OCN, SCN, SF 5 , trimethylsilyl, methyl, ethyl, propyl, isobutyl, butyl, sec-butyl, isopropyl, tert-butyl, trifluoromethyl, (2,2,2)-trifluoroethyl, difluoromethyl, (2,2)-difluoroethyl, trichloromethyl, (2,2,2)-trichloroethyl, vinyl, ethynyl, allyl, butenyl, propynyl, methylcarbonyl, ethylcarbonyl, propylcarbonyl, methoxycarbonyl, ethoxycarbonyl, methylsulphonylamino, ethylsulphonylamino, propylsulphonylamino, aminosulphonyl, methylaminosulphonyl, ethylaminosulphonyl, propylaminosulphonyl, dimethylaminosulphonyl, diethylaminosulphonyl, aminothiocarbonyl, methylaminothiocarbonyl, ethylaminothiocarbonyl, dimethylaminothiocarbonyl or diethylaminothiocarbonyl;  or represent cyclopropyl, cyclobutyl, cyclopentyl or cyclohexyl which are mono- or polysubstituted by identical or different substituents from the group consisting of fluorine, chlorine, bromine, cyano, nitro, methyl, ethyl, methoxy, ethoxy, trifluoromethyl and cyclopropyl;  or represent cyclopropylmethyl or cyclobutylmethyl which are mono- or polysubstituted by identical or different substituents from the group consisting of fluorine, chlorine, bromine, cyano, nitro, methyl, ethyl, methoxy, ethoxy, trifluoromethyl and cyclopropyl; Q represents C—V; where V represents hydrogen, fluorine, chlorine, bromine, methyl, ethyl, propyl, isobutyl, butyl, sec-butyl, isopropyl, tert-butyl, trifluoromethyl, (2,2,2)-trifluoroethyl, difluoromethyl, (2,2)-difluoroethyl; W represents hydrogen or fluorine; X and Y independently of one another represent hydrogen, fluorine, chlorine, bromine, methyl, ethyl, trifluoromethyl, difluoromethyl, difluoromethoxy, trifluoromethoxy, cyclopropyl, cyano or nitro; Z represents hydrogen; n represents the number 0 or 1. 2.
